Early and Family Life
Eileen Harris is American and married to Englishman John Harris, has a son, Lucian Guthrie, and a daughter, Georgina, and lives in London and Badminton, Gloucestershire, UK. Eileen Harris (née Spiegel) was born in 1932 to Paul Spiegel and Irene Stein in the city of Brooklyn, New York. Eileen also has a younger brother, Michael Ivan Spiegel, who was born on December 25, 1934.
